Configuração de VPS e ambiente de operação 24 horas com MT5 — fundamentos para manter o EA sempre ativo
Última atualização: 20/05/2026 | Tempo de leitura: 15 min
Um EA só tem valor se operar continuamente enquanto o mercado estiver ativo — 24 horas por dia, 7 dias por semana. Manter o PC doméstico ligado é uma opção, mas há riscos de queda de energia, reinicializações e quedas de conexão. Com um VPS (servidor virtual privado), seu EA continua rodando na nuvem mesmo com o PC desligado.
Índice
Por que um VPS é necessário para operar com EA
O EA só funciona enquanto o MT5 está ativo. Se o PC entrar em modo de suspensão ou for desligado, o EA para imediatamente — sem executar entradas nem fechamentos de posição. Se o PC travar com uma posição em aberto, o stop loss também não será acionado.
Um VPS é um PC virtual em um data center que opera 24 horas por dia. Você se conecta remotamente pelo seu PC ou smartphone, e quando encerra a conexão, o MT5 no VPS continua rodando. Em termos de proteção contra queda de energia, estabilidade de conexão e velocidade de execução, o VPS é sempre superior ao PC doméstico.
Principais razões para usar um VPS
- ✓O EA continua rodando mesmo com o PC desligado (operação 24 horas)
- ✓Menos vulnerável a quedas de energia, reinicializações do OS e quedas de conexão
- ✓Mais próximo dos servidores do broker, com execução mais rápida e menor slippage
- ✓Não consome os recursos do seu PC pessoal
Requisitos de hardware para escolher um VPS
Referência para rodar 1 a 3 instâncias do MT5. Os requisitos variam conforme o número de EAs e a complexidade dos cálculos.
| Especificação | Mínimo | Recomendado |
|---|---|---|
| Memória (RAM) | 2 GB | 4 GB ou mais |
| CPU | 1 núcleo | 2 núcleos ou mais |
| Armazenamento | 30 GB SSD | 50 GB SSD ou mais |
| Disponibilidade (SLA) | 99,9% | 99,99% |
| Localização | Mesma região do servidor de trading | Próximo a Londres ou Nova York |
| OS | Windows Server | Windows Server 2019 ou posterior |
Diferenças entre VPS gratuito e VPS comercial
| Critério | VPS gratuito do broker | VPS comercial |
|---|---|---|
| Custo | Gratuito (sujeito a condições de volume de trading) | Cerca de R$ 50 a 150/mês |
| Condições de uso | Requer saldo mínimo, volume ou lotes negociados | Sem condições |
| Broker | Fixo ao broker que oferece o serviço | Compatível com qualquer broker |
| Hardware | Geralmente configuração mínima | Planos configuráveis |
| Ideal para | Quem já tem volume suficiente naquele broker | Quem usa múltiplos brokers com flexibilidade |
Procedimento de configuração do MT5
Conectar-se ao VPS remotamente
No Windows, use a Conexão de Área de Trabalho Remota; no Mac, use o aplicativo 'Microsoft Remote Desktop'. Insira o endereço IP, nome de usuário e senha do VPS para conectar.
Instalar o MT5
No navegador do VPS, baixe o MT5 do site oficial do seu broker e instale. Faça login com o ID da conta de trading, senha e nome do servidor.
Instalar o EA
Coloque o arquivo do EA na pasta MQL5/Experts do diretório de dados. Arquivos .mq5 precisam ser compilados no MetaEditor. Ao reiniciar o MT5, o EA aparece no painel 'Navigator'.
Ativar o trading automático
Ative o botão 'Negociação automática' na barra de ferramentas e arraste o EA para o gráfico desejado. Permita o trading automático nas configurações do EA — quando um ícone de rosto aparecer no canto superior direito do gráfico, o EA está ativo.
Confirmar que o EA opera mesmo após desconectar
Feche a conexão remota, aguarde alguns instantes e reconecte. Verifique se o EA continua rodando e se o histórico de trades foi atualizado. Se sim, a operação via VPS está funcionando.
Verificações diárias para operação estável 24 horas
Não dependa completamente do VPS — verifique os itens a seguir pelo menos uma vez por dia.
Status da conexão entre MT5 e broker
O indicador de conexão no canto inferior direito da tela deve estar verde (recebendo dados). Se estiver vermelho, faça login novamente.
Trading automático está ativado
Verifique o botão 'Negociação automática' e o ícone de rosto no gráfico. Após uma reinicialização do VPS, o trading automático pode ter sido desativado.
Margem disponível
Verifique se posições inesperadas ou perdas não realizadas não estão reduzindo a margem. Se estiver em nível crítico, interrompa o EA e avalie a situação.
Recursos do VPS
Verifique se o uso de memória RAM não está consistentemente alto. Reiniciar o MT5 periodicamente ajuda a prevenir memory leaks.
Logs e erros
Verifique as abas 'Experts' e 'Journal' do MT5 em busca de erros. Se houver erros de ordem recorrentes, investigue a causa.
🖥️ Compare opções de VPS
Neste site, comparamos serviços de VPS adequados para operação de EAs por preço, hardware e localização. As condições dos VPS gratuitos também estão resumidas.
Ver comparativo de VPS →